RE: Av receiver for B&W dm600 S3 5.1 setup

MrKay00 wrote:

Hi MUSICRAFT,

 

do you think i should sell my current setup and get the B&W MT-30 would they be better then the setup i have now thanks


Hi MrKay00

No. I'll recommend that you carry on using your speakers for a while yet as these 600 series speakers are some of the finest which B&W have produced and are also capable of higher levels of performance then the MT-30. Adding a ASW675 will be the icing on the cake Smile

Btw, is £500 your limit for an AV amp? The reason i ask is because as good the RX-V671and other amps are at this level however your speakers can benefit further from even higher calibre of amplification. Something worth bearing in mind.

RE: Av receiver for B&W dm600 S3 5.1 setup

MrKay00 wrote:

Hi,

thanks for your reply again. I wanted to stay in the £500 mark but can go over. how much is it and what make and model are they thanks 

Hi mrkay00

Your welcome.

Staying close to the £500 mark Yamaha's new Aventage RX-A810 (RRP £850) is worth a look. As good as the RX-V671 is however the RX-A810's overall quality of power and performance are much better which your 600 series will easily benefit from Smile Alternatively the recently discontinued RX-V1067, RX-V2067 and RX-V3067 are also worth considering as you may still find these amps at very good prices.
